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Norwich to Liverpool Central start from as little as £32.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Norwich to Liverpool Central start from £117.30 one way, or £145.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Norwich to Liverpool Central are available for £130.30 one way, or £215.80 return

Facilities and Services

Stepping into Norwich Station, you are greeted with a wide array of amenities designed to make your journey as smooth as possible. The station is fully accessible, offering step-free access throughout, including accessible ticket machines and toilets. For those needing assistance, staff help is available throughout the week, with prominent information available at the ticket office. There is also a free water refill point and vending machines for snacks.

Want some coffee for the road? You’re in luck. Enjoy a fresh brew from AMT Coffee, or take your pick from a Costa Coffee or Starbucks, all conveniently located within the station.

Ticketing and Smart Solutions

For ticket purchases, Norwich Train Station offers a dedicated ticket office open from early morning till late in the evening, ensuring that you can organize your journey at any time of day. Ticket machines are readily available, and for those using smartcards, there are validators and issuance facilities onsite. The lack of a customer help point could be a slight hiccup in an otherwise seamless service experience.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Norwich is well-connected with vast transport links to other areas. For those in search of local exploration, the Norwich PLUSBUS ticket allows for unlimited bus travel within the city when purchased in conjunction with your train ticket. Furthermore, the rail replacement and bus services are conveniently accessible directly from the station forecourt.

Facilities and Amenities

Liverpool Central Station is equipped to meet a variety of passenger needs. The ticket office operates from early morning until late at night, ensuring travelers can purchase or collect tickets conveniently. Ticket machines are available but do note that they are not designed for accessible use. For those utilizing smartcards, issuance is possible at the station, although validators are not currently available.

Accessibility is a prime focus at Liverpool Central, ensuring step-free access throughout the station. While there are no dedicated parking facilities, visitors can take advantage of accessible toilets and waiting areas. Staff assistance is readily available every day of the week for those who need it, adding an extra layer of support for all passengers.

Dining and Shopping Options

The station features several refreshment and shopping options. Whether you need to grab a quick bite from a vending machine or pick up some essentials from the variety of shops housed on site, such as a convenience store or even a shoe repair service, Liverpool Central has got you covered. An ATM is also available for any immediate cash needs.

Onward Travel Connections

Navigating to and from Liverpool Central is straightforward. Rail replacement services, if needed, can be found at 32 Great Charlotte Street, just moments away from the station. For local travels, comprehensive bus routes are available, with detailed travel information provided by Merseytravel or by contacting Traveline.

For those needing to reach Liverpool John Lennon Airport, there's a convenient rail/bus ticket option from any Merseyrail station to the airport, courtesy of the 86A or 80A buses departing from Liverpool South Parkway station, arriving at the airport within a short 10-minute ride.
